芯片测试需要掌握的一些关键技术
日期:2024-07-25 15:00:00 浏览量:222 标签: 芯片测试
芯片测试是确保芯片功能和性能的重要环节。以下是芯片测试需要掌握的一些关键技术:
1. 基础测试技术
1.1 电参数测试
· 直流参数测试:测试芯片的基本电参数,如电源电压、电流消耗、输入输出电压电流等。
· 交流参数测试:测试芯片的交流特性,如频率响应、增益、相位等。
1.2 功能测试
· 逻辑测试:测试数字芯片的逻辑功能,验证其逻辑门电路和状态转换是否正确。
· 模拟功能测试:测试模拟芯片的功能,如放大器的增益、滤波器的频率响应等。
2. 自动化测试技术
2.1 自动测试设备(ATE)
· 介绍:使用自动测试设备进行大规模芯片测试,提高测试效率和准确性。
· 功能:ATE可以自动完成电参数测试、功能测试和环境测试等。
2.2 测试程序开发
· 编写测试程序:根据芯片规格和测试要求编写测试程序,控制ATE进行测试。
· 优化测试流程:优化测试程序和流程,提高测试速度和覆盖率。
3. 测试矢量生成和验证
3.1 测试矢量生成
· 静态矢量:生成用于测试静态逻辑功能的测试矢量。
· 动态矢量:生成用于测试动态逻辑功能的测试矢量,如时序测试矢量。
3.2 矢量验证
· 仿真验证:使用仿真工具验证测试矢量的正确性,确保其覆盖所有测试场景。
· 实际验证:在实际芯片上验证测试矢量,确保其能有效检测芯片的功能和性能。
4. 故障诊断和分析技术
4.1 故障定位
· 失效分析:使用工具和方法,如红外热成像、X射线、声学显微镜等,定位故障位置。
· 电路追踪:根据电路图和测试结果,追踪故障源头,找到具体失效的元器件或电路。
4.2 故障分类
· 系统性故障:分析系统性故障的原因,如设计缺陷、工艺问题等。
· 随机性故障:分析随机性故障的原因,如环境因素、老化等。
5. 环境和可靠性测试技术
5.1 环境测试
· 温度测试:测试芯片在不同温度下的性能,如高温、低温和温度循环测试。
· 湿度测试:测试芯片在高湿度环境下的性能,检测其耐湿性。
5.2 可靠性测试
· 寿命测试:通过长期连续运行测试芯片的寿命,评估其长期稳定性。
· 应力测试:通过施加电气、热、机械应力测试芯片的可靠性,如电压应力测试、机械冲击测试等。
6. 信号完整性和电源完整性测试
6.1 信号完整性测试
· 时序分析:测试芯片的时序特性,确保信号在传输过程中不失真。
· 噪声分析:测试芯片的噪声特性,分析信号传输过程中的噪声源和干扰。
6.2 电源完整性测试
· 电源噪声测试:测试电源噪声对芯片的影响,确保电源供应的稳定性。
· 电源瞬态响应测试:测试芯片对电源电压变化的响应,确保其在电源波动时能正常工作。
7. 仿真和建模技术
7.1 电路仿真
· SPICE仿真:使用SPICE等仿真工具进行电路级仿真,验证芯片设计的正确性。
· 系统仿真:使用系统仿真工具进行系统级仿真,验证芯片在系统中的工作情况。
7.2 建模技术
· 行为建模:建立芯片的行为模型,用于功能验证和性能评估。
· 统计建模:建立芯片的统计模型,用于分析工艺波动对芯片性能的影响。
通过掌握以上技术,工程师可以进行全面的芯片测试,确保芯片的功能和性能符合要求,从而提高产品的质量和可靠性。